The Spaced Repetition System

The Ebbinghaus forgetting curve shows we forget roughly 70% of new information within 24 hours. Spaced repetition counters this by reviewing a word right before it fades, then spacing the next review further out as your confidence grows.

  • Correct answer: Word advances to the next box with a longer interval
  • Wrong answer: Word returns to Box 1 for more practice
  • Result: You spend less time on words you know. More time building the ones you don't.
